About La Concha Beach

La Concha Beach sits at the heart of San Sebastián (Donostia), curving gracefully along the Bay of Biscay in Spain's Basque Country. Widely regarded as one of the finest urban beaches in Europe, its horseshoe-shaped bay, calm waters, and elegant promenade make it a defining feature of the city.

The Beach and Its Setting

La Concha — meaning "the shell" in Spanish — takes its name from the distinctive shell-like curve of its shoreline. The beach stretches roughly 1.35 kilometres and is flanked by the wooded hill of Monte Urgull to the east and Monte Igueldo to the west. The calm, sheltered waters are ideal for swimming, and the fine golden sand draws both locals and visitors throughout the warmer months. A classic Victorian-style balustrade promenade, the Paseo de la Concha, runs the length of the beach and is perfect for a leisurely walk at any time of year. Just offshore sits the small island of Santa Clara, reachable by boat during summer.

Culture and Surroundings

The beach sits within easy reach of several key attractions. The San Telmo Museum, one of the oldest museums in the Basque Country, is a short walk away. Monte Urgull offers panoramic views over the bay and city, while Monte Igueldo provides a broader coastal panorama accessible by a historic funicular railway. The surrounding old town (Parte Vieja) is renowned for its pintxos bars and vibrant food culture.

Practical Tips

  • Best time to visit: July and August for swimming; spring and autumn for quieter walks along the promenade.
  • Getting there: The beach is walkable from the city centre; local buses also serve the area.
  • Facilities: Sunbed and umbrella rentals, showers, and lifeguard services are available in summer.
  • Boat to Santa Clara: Seasonal boat services run from the beach to the island between June and September.

FAQ

Q: Is La Concha Beach suitable for families with children? A: Yes. The sheltered bay produces calm, relatively gentle waves, making it well suited for families and young swimmers.

Q: Is the beach free to access? A: Access to the beach is free. Sunbed and umbrella rentals are available for a fee during the summer season.

Q: Can you swim to the island of Santa Clara from La Concha? A: Strong swimmers do make the crossing, but the recommended option is the seasonal boat service that runs during summer months.

Q: Is La Concha Beach crowded in summer? A: August in particular sees very high visitor numbers. Arriving early in the morning is the most effective way to secure a good spot on the sand.
